#264d33 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#264d33 is composed of 14.9% red, 30.2%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 33.8% yellow and 69.8% black. It has a hue angle of 140 degrees, a saturation of 33.9% and a lightness of 22.5%. #264d33 color hex could be obtained by blending #4c9a66 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#264d33

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060b08 is the darkest color, while #fdf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#264d33

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#383b39 is the less saturated color, while #037027 is the most saturated one.
